Thought I'd blow the dust off this topic and post some early thoughts on a game I started today. I got Sonic Colors for my birthday this week. It's the first 3D Sonic game I've played since Sonic and the Secret Rings which I've never completed. Never cared for the motion controls in that game, it made it so much more difficult to control. But I've been really enjoying Colors so far. I've beaten the first 3 worlds already, so I can tell it's not going to be a very long game. I'm surprised how short some of the acts are actually. But I can tell they want you to come back and replay levels after you unlock the Wisps in later levels in order to get the Red Rings, since that's the only way to get many of them. I've done a bit of that already as well. The Wisp powers are pretty interesting. Kinda odd how the Hover and Spike powers pretty much replaces the Light Speed Dash and Spin Dash.
